Output 321f0e61ab123816efdcb6928a59a29cf3f8dead2f97cf7042ca76a3f6045703:0

value
84390200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ac5164ed28f0b5f7624869bda53eebf3391fe39 OP_EQUAL
address
MLYuakt1U7UEKpeajRLabRSvC4uroh9VBd
transaction
321f0e61ab123816efdcb6928a59a29cf3f8dead2f97cf7042ca76a3f6045703
spent
true